WORLD ECONOMIC FORUM: “Rebuilding Trust” - Davos 2024

The 54th edition of the World Economic Forum is being held in Davos, with the participation of over sixty heads of state and government and around three thousand protagonists from one hundred and twenty countries in different economic, political, scientific, and cultural worlds. The meeting, held annually since 1971, has been one of the most important events in the field of economic and social policy at a global level, during which many principal challenges are discussed.

The title of the 2024 edition is "Rebuilding Trust." These are some of the themes to be discussed: building a safer world, reformulating the lines of dialogue, economic growth, climate change, and artificial intelligence. At a time when the five wealthiest men in the world have more than doubled their assets, from $405 billion to $869 billion since 2020, the event analyzes many social contrasts. In over 200 work sessions the protagonists take note of the uncertainty that permeates the global scenario torn apart by wars and seek answers capable of rebuilding trust in the future, not only from an economic point of view but also from a geopolitical one.

Within the event, there will also be the Open Forum Davos, the World Economic Forum event open to the public which allows participants to engage in discussions between political, economic, scientific, and civil society leaders. "From the Laboratory to Life: Science in Action" is this year's theme which focuses on the role of science and its impact on all sectors of life and the planet.
